Output e09c59b26a9351e658455061b37493368acf21ecf23edda15efbc4ac85f4a903:1454

value
301592
script pubkey
OP_0 OP_PUSHBYTES_20 f78068b720fbe7707358db83ed3980e5e5c79d62
address
tb1q77qx3deql0nhqu6cmwp76wvquhju08tz85glnz
transaction
e09c59b26a9351e658455061b37493368acf21ecf23edda15efbc4ac85f4a903
confirmations
1130
spent
false